Selling for a friend on another forum

Trying to sell the Cobra. Just no time or desire lately to take it. Car needs nothing but a updated tune and should run 8's without much effort. Or drop 2000hp in it and go run with the big dogs.
Wont find a nicer car for the money. 100k has been invested in this one and have all documentation to show.

This is just a quick rundown, can send full list to anyone interested.
03 Cobra 27k miles (body)
All factory metal on the car even the stock hood.
25.2 Chromoly cage currently certified to 6.0
ProLine built 4.6 with freshened heads, stock cams, (NX kit), Skinny Kid motor plates
Meizere water pumps
KB 2.8 Mammoth Kit
Kooks SS 1 7/8 with 3.5 collectors, Kooks 3.5 X -pipe, Magnaflow polished race muffs
coil on plug LS1 coils
16v electric system with 2 XS batteries
BS3 stand alone
165lb injectors
Aeromotive 2000hp Eliminator fuel pump
Neal Chance Limited Street Powerglide (Precision Kwik Shift shifter and co2 bottle)
Custom 9in bolt together Neal Chance Converter, JW flexplate and Bell housing
Custom built 4 link, 9in rear Moser center section and lightweight spool
40 spline gundrilled axles, custom driveshaft, 4.30 gear
Team Z K member , a arms,
Strange Coil overs, struts etc
Racecraft drop spindles
Strange Brakes and Master cylinder, Aerospace brakes in rear
Alumastar 2.0's front 15x3.5 and rear wheels 15x14 rears, 33x10.5 MT rear slicks, MT front runners
The list just goes on and on

This car is setup to say the least, if you know anyone looking to build a race car they could save a tone of money with this one.
55k turnkey
40k rolling (minus motor and tranny)
